Biological function: A total of 241 CDECs, including 75 upregulated and 166 downregulated CDECs, were identified in three OS cell lines compared with normal vascular endothelial cells. PCR validation showed that hsa_circ_0000704, hsa_circ_0001017 and hsa_circ_0005035 were all highly expression in the three OS cell lines, compared with osteoblast cell lines (HECC, hFOB1.19 and HFF-1).
Molecular mechanism: overexpression of circ_0001017 significantly promoted the cell proliferation, migration and invasion and decreased apoptosis in U2OS cells. Knockdown of circ_0001017 obtained the opposite results. Circ_0001017 may downregulate hsa-miR-145-5p through direct binding. Furthermore, the expression of hsa-miR-145-5p was negatively regulated by circ_0001017 in OS cells. In addition, further functional studies indicated that hsa-miR-145-5p inhibitor eliminated the effects caused by si-circ_0001017 in OS cells.

In conclusion, our study suggested that circ_0001017 may be a novel oncogenic factor during the progression and development of OS by targeting miR-145-5p.
